Introducing the Anthurium Red Spider: A Captivating Tropical Beauty

Bring the allure of a tropical paradise right into your living space with the Anthurium Red Spider. A stunning addition to any indoor garden arrangement, this exquisite plant is known for its striking red veins, distinctive spider-like shaped veiny leaf, and glossy green foliage. With its unique appearance and effortless elegance, the Anthurium Red Spider is sure to captivate and enhance the ambiance of any room.

Cultivating your Anthurium Forgetii 'Red Spider' requires a balance of indirect light, consistent warmth, and humidity reminiscent of its native tropical environment. With well-draining soil and careful watering, this plant will thrive and reward you with its stunning visual appeal.
